Outreach AI pricing is not publicly disclosed and is available only via custom quote. The cost structure uses a hybrid of seat-based fees and consumption-based usage across four Amplify plan tiers.
Outreach AI costs are determined by a combination of the number of seats and the volume of consumption your team requires. Because pricing is not public, buyers must request a quote tailored to their specific pipeline and revenue acceleration needs.
The platform offers four distinct tiers: Amplify Essentials, Core, Plus, and Pro. These range from basic support for pipeline creation to full suites of AI agents designed for comprehensive revenue acceleration.

How does the hybrid pricing model work?
Outreach employs a consumption-based model alongside traditional seat licenses. This means your total investment scales based on how frequently your team utilizes AI agents and features. For Finance and Sales Ops, this requires a clear forecast of activity volume to manage the variable cost component of the contract.
Which Amplify plan is right for your team?
Choosing a plan depends on your primary sales objective. The Essentials and Core plans are geared toward teams focused on building pipeline. The Plus and Pro plans are designed for revenue acceleration and include broader access to the suite of AI agents. Since specific limits and rates are not stated publicly, the decision often hinges on the depth of automation required for your sales workflow.

Frequently asked questions
What is the starting price for Outreach Amplify?
Outreach does not state a starting price on its website. Pricing is provided upon request and depends on your specific usage needs and seat count.
Does Outreach AI use seat-based or usage-based pricing?
It uses a combination of both. You pay for the seats your team needs plus a consumption-based fee based on your usage of the AI features.
What are the available Outreach AI plans?
There are four plans: Amplify Essentials, Amplify Core, Amplify Plus, and Outreach Amplify Pro. Each is tailored to different levels of sales activity and revenue goals.
